+# Implementing Health 2.1 HAL
+
+1. Install common binderized service. The binderized service `dlopen()`s
+ passthrough implementations on the device, so there is no need to write
+ your own.
+
+ ```mk
+ # Install default binderized implementation to vendor.
+ PRODUCT_PACKAGES += android.hardware.health@2.1-service
+ ```
+
+1. Delete existing VINTF manifest entry. Search for `android.hardware.health` in
+ your device manifest, and delete the whole `<hal>` entry for older versions
+ of the HAL. Instead, when `android.hardware.health@2.1-service` is installed,
+ a VINTF manifest fragment is installed to `/vendor/etc/vintf`, so there is
+ no need to manually specify it in your device manifest. See
+ [Manifest fragments](https://source.android.com/devices/architecture/vintf/objects#manifest-fragments)
+ for details.
+
+1. Install the proper passthrough implemetation.
+
+ 1. If you want to use default implementation:
+
+ ```mk
+ # Install default passthrough implementation to vendor.
+ PRODUCT_PACKAGES += android.hardware.health@2.1-impl
+ ```
+
+ You are done. Otherwise, go to the next step.
+
+ 1. If you want to write your own implementation,
+
+ 1. Copy skeleton implementation from the [appendix](#impl).
+
+ 1. Modify the implementation to suit your needs.
+
+ * If you have a board or device specific `libhealthd`, see
+ [Upgrading with a customized libhealthd](#update-from-1-0).
+ * If you are upgrading from 1.0 health HAL, see
+ [Upgrading from Health HAL 1.0](#update-from-1-0).
+ * If you are upgrading from a customized 2.0 health HAL
+ implementation, See
+ [Upgrading from Health HAL 2.0](#update-from-2-0).
+
+ 1. [Update necessary SELinux permissions](#selinux).
+
+ 1. [Fix `/charger` symlink](#charger-symlink).
+
+# Upgrading with a customized libhealthd or from Health HAL 1.0 {#update-from-1-0}
+
+`libhealthd` contains two functions: `healthd_board_init()` and
+`healthd_board_battery_update()`. Similarly, Health HAL 1.0 contains `init()`
+and `update()`, with an additional `energyCounter()` function.
+
+* `healthd_board_init()` / `@1.0::IHealth.init()` should be called before
+ passing the `healthd_config` struct to your `HealthImpl` class. See
+ `HIDL_FETCH_IHealth` in [`HealthImpl.cpp`](#health_impl_cpp).
+
+* `healthd_board_battery_update()` / `@1.0::IHealth.update()` should be called
+ in `HealthImpl::UpdateHealthInfo()`. Example:
+
+ ```c++
+ void HealthImpl::UpdateHealthInfo(HealthInfo* health_info) {
+ struct BatteryProperties props;
+ convertFromHealthInfo(health_info->legacy.legacy, &props);
+ healthd_board_battery_update(&props);
+ convertToHealthInfo(&props, health_info->legacy.legacy);
+ }
+ ```
+ For efficiency, you should move code in `healthd_board_battery_update` to
+ `HealthImpl::UpdateHealthInfo` and modify `health_info` directly to avoid
+ conversion to `BatteryProperties`.
+
+* Code for `@1.0::IHealth.energyCounter()` should be moved to
+ `HealthImpl::getEnergyCounter()`. Example:
+
+ ```c++
+ Return<void> Health::getEnergyCounter(getEnergyCounter_cb _hidl_cb) {
+ int64_t energy = /* ... */;
+ _hidl_cb(Result::SUCCESS, energy);
+ return Void();
+ }
+ ```
+
+# Upgrading from Health HAL 2.0 {#update-from-2-0}
+
+* If you have implemented `healthd_board_init()` and/or
+ `healthd_board_battery_update()` (instead of using `libhealthd.default`),
+ see [the section above](#update-from-1-0)
+ for instructions to convert them.
+
+* If you have implemented `get_storage_info()` and/or `get_disk_stats()`
+ (instead of using libhealthstoragedefault), implement `HealthImpl::getDiskStats`
+ and/or `HealthImpl::getStorageInfo` directly. There is no need to override
+ `HealthImpl::getHealthInfo` or `HealthImpl::getHealthInfo_2_1` because they call
+ `getDiskStats` and `getStorageInfo` to retrieve storage information.

+# Fix `/charger` symlink {#charger-symlink}
+If you are using `/charger` in your `init.rc` scripts, it is recommended
+(required for devices running in Android R) that the path is changed to
+`/system/bin/charger` instead.
+
+Search for `service charger` in your device configuration directory to see if
+this change applies to your device. Below is an example of how the script should
+look like:
+
+```
+service charger /system/bin/charger
+ class charger
+ user system
+ group system wakelock input
+ capabilities SYS_BOOT
+ file /dev/kmsg w
+ file /sys/fs/pstore/console-ramoops-0 r
+ file /sys/fs/pstore/console-ramoops r
+ file /proc/last_kmsg r
+```
